Independent Handlers Coalition Predicts Large 2011 Crop

The Independent Handlers Coalition today released its official Subjective Forecast on the 2011 California Walnut Crop at 523,000 tons. This would represent a 4.4% increase from the 2010 crop of 501,000 tons. Handlers believe that growing conditions thus far have been nearly ideal, with moderate summertime temperatures.

Nut size will again be an issue for the industry as was the case last year, according to most handlers.

GoldRiver Receives Red Seal Award For Sanitation

GoldRiver Orchards is the proud recipient of the Red Seal Pinnacle Award, given in recognition of exceptional performance in the area of plant sanitation and good manufacturing practices by the American Council for Food Safety and Quality (ACFSQ).

ACFSQ performs surprise audits on member facilities tri-annually. In order to achieve the Red Seal Pinnacle Award, a plant must achieve a top score of 1800 or better on all three of those audits in a given crop year.

This is GoldRiver's second Pinnacle Award in a row. The award was presented on 20 July 2011 at Brookside Country Club in Stockton, California.
